Tiwa Savage Overcomes Backstage Clash at Ghana Festival

Nigerian music superstar Tiwa Savage proved once again why she remains one of Africa’s most respected performers, overcoming backstage tension to deliver a powerful performance at the Taste The Culture Festival in Accra, Ghana.

The event, held at the iconic Black Star Square, reportedly experienced technical and scheduling challenges that sparked a heated moment backstage involving the award-winning singer.

According to eyewitnesses, the issue stemmed from faulty sound equipment and an overlap between her set and that of fellow artiste Black Sherif.

Visibly frustrated, Tiwa Savage was heard expressing her displeasure, stressing the sacrifice she made to be at the event.

“Don’t tell me to calm down. I am going home,” she said in a now-viral clip from backstage. “I left my son at home just to perform here.”

Event organisers quickly intervened, calming the situation and resolving the technical hiccups. Shortly after, Tiwa Savage returned to the stage and delivered a flawless performance that drew massive cheers from the crowd.

Dressed in bold, statement outfits, the singer commanded the stage with her signature confidence, powerful vocals, and hit-filled setlist. Her performance stood out as one of the night’s highlights, reaffirming her status as a seasoned live performer.

The festival also featured stellar performances from Omah Lay, King Promise, Gyakie, Amaarae, and Black Sherif, celebrating Ghanaian culture through music, food, and fashion.

Fans and social media users praised Tiwa Savage for demanding professionalism while still delivering excellence on stage. Many applauded her for turning a tense moment into a triumphant performance, describing her as a true professional who holds organisers to high standards.

Despite the backstage clash, Tiwa Savage’s commanding presence and electrifying performance ensured the night remained unforgettable.
